Optimal Integration Designed jointly by Sena and Shoei, the SRL2 is a commuication system tailored specifically to the Shoei Neotec II helmet â is the upgraded version of the wildly popular Neotec modular helmet. The SRL2 is virtually undetectable from the outside of the helmet, and functions with a simple 3-button control. Connectivity Simplified A dual Bluetooth chip allows for up to 8 intercom connections as well as simultaneously listen to music and talk to other riders via Intercom using Audio Multitasking. When audio comes through the Intercom music will automatically decrease in volume, and return to a normal volume when riders stop talking over the Intercom. Simply pair the SRL2 with your smartphone to stream music, listen to GPS directions, and take and make phone calls. A Feature Set to Keep you Moving in the Right Direction Take your ride up a notch with the stellar feature set of the SRL2. In addition to the the Universal and Group Intercom features, the SRL2 offers music sharing and Senaâs Advanced Noise Control technology. Smart volume regulates the volume of your music when the environment outside of your helmet changes, due to wind noise or increased speed. Built in FM radio lets riders easily scan through and save radio stations.
Stay connected and in control with the Sena Smartphone app Linking the SRL2 with the Sena Smartphone App (for iPhone and Android) allows you to configure device settings and access our quick guide at the click of a button. The SRL2 can also easily connect to the Sena RideConnected App to intercom with a virtually limitless amount of riders over an infinite range, so long as you are connected to a mobile network. Chaser-X is the third Arai helmet that makes use of the new VAS (variable Axis System) technology that offers a significant larger and smoother shell area above the SNELL test line greatly improving the important helmet glancing off performance. The Chaser-X makes use of an also completely new ventilation system derived from the RX-7V, instantly recognizable by the large, single intake duct on top of the helmet. This Top Ventilation System is derived from the RX-7V diffuser system. The replaceable interior is lined with an anti-microbial fabric. The Chaser-X features FCS (Facial Contour System) and a fixed, non-retractable mini chin cover. The chin vent is also new, while the Formula One developed visor lock system is the same as used on the RX-7V. All Chaser-X helmets come with a standard Max Vision visor with a Pinlock inlay lens separately packed in the box. Chaser-X Ventilation: New system The Chaser-X features an exclusive ventilation system that is unique to this model. It is instantly recognizable by the large intake and exhaust duct on the front part of the helmet. The large inlet allows generous amounts of cool, fresh air to enter the helmet, assisted by the two inlets in the large single frame rear duct. The exhaust function of the large front duct keeps working when the intake is closed. The two small exhaust vents on the back of the helmet help to quickly dispose hot, warm air from the helmets interior. Shell Construction SFL Special Fibre Laminate Strict quality controlled construction using special fibre layers, crowded with fibres right to the shell surfaces and bonded with special resins formulated by Arai, to disperse impact energy over the widest possible area â the shellâs main job â through strength, structural integrity and impact flexibility. Variable Axis System (VAS) With VAS, the visor mounting position is lowered, yielding an average of an additional 24mm across both temple areas, in pursuit of the ideal smoother shape that increases the ability of glancing off energy. As a result, this has made it possible for more of the shell to be smoother along and above the test line of the Snell standard. Penetration tested All Arai helmets are penetration tested, although not required by European helmet standards. The Arai penetration test is performed with a 3kg test cone that strikes from a height of 3m on the helmet. Double-D ring device The flat and D-shaped rings fit smooth against the chin. No moving parts, no corrosion problems and just pulling the tab is enough to loosen the fastener. Smooth shape, better protection The smooth outer shell of Arai helmets is designed to glide without unnecessary resistance. You donât want to decelerate your helmet more than necessary. Thatâs why all Arai vents and ducts are designed to break off during an impact. Hard outer shell, soft inner shell Arai uses a very hard outer shell to spread impact forces and a soft inner shell to absorb remaining energy. The multiple-density EPS inner shell is made using a unique technology of combining three to five densities in various areas as a single component. Organic shape The organic shape of an Arai outer shell offers a more natural appearance, seals better and conforms more to the headâs natural shape for improved comfort, fit and to help minimize wind turbulence. 5-year limited warranty All Arai helmets are warranted against defects in materials and workmanship, and are serviceable only for the properly fitted first user for 5 years from date of first use, but no more than 7 years from date of manufacture. Different outer shells Unlike many other manufacturers Arai provides one size outer shell for each two-helmet sizes for most models. Together with different shaped outer shells for different models it is almost impossible not to find the fit you are looking for. Arai In-house test This Arai helmet is designed to meet the stringent Arai In-house standard requirements, in addition to mandatory standards such as ECE 22-05 and voluntary standards such as SNELL M2010.
The Protone weighs just 215g and uses a 3D Dry padding with a multi-layer open cell construction process to give a more comfortable ride.It has removable and washable inner padding¸ made from CoolMax® fabrics and its inner padding fabric has been treated using the Sanitized® antimicrobial process. KASK has also continued to use its Multi In-Moulding Technology to create a polycarbonate cover for the top¸ base ring and the back of the helmet’s shell. This is joined to the inner polystyrene cap via KASK’s In-Moulding Technology to improve the shell’s shock absorption. Its strengthened frame further reduces the risk of a shock breaking the shell
Das funktionelle Trainingsprogramm, um Beschwerden zu lindern, die Haltung zu verbessern und Muskeln aufzubauen Unzählige Menschen quälen sich regelmäßig mit Rückenschmerzen und wissen nicht, dass sie selbst etwas dagegen tun können. Mit den Übungen und den drei Trainingsprogrammen in diesem Buch haben der Chiropraktiker Eric Goodman und der Profitrainer Peter Park einen Korrekturansatz konzipiert, der darauf ausgerichtet ist, ungünstige Bewegungsmuster zu verbessern und eine kraftvolle Rückenmuskulatur zu entwickeln. Dabei wird der Core-Bereich ganz neu herausgebildet, indem der Fokus von der Vorderseite des Körpers auf die Körperrückseite verlagert wird. Mit nur 20 Minuten Training an drei Tagen der Woche können Anfänger ebenso wie erfahrene Sportler mit diesem einfachen Programm nicht nur ihre Haltung korrigieren und Rückenschmerzen deutlich lindern, sondern auch ihre Fitness und ihre Leistung steigern.
